[QUOTE="Dirty Dog, post: 452091, member: 24042"] Small update to this post. As I said, I just used the new speaker as a template and drilled new mounting holes. Not everybody wants to drill holes in their Jeep. [USER=19161]@Anybodyhome[/USER] had an alternative. You can get [URL='https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B000NWEJWA/?tag=jkforum-20']THIS[/URL] pair of adapters, with or without a harness. The adapter bolts to your speaker and will mate to the OEM mounting holes. The optional harness plugs into your existing connection and has spade connectors on the other end. This is a good option if you think you might want to go back to the stock speakers at some point. I can't imagine why you would, but it's an option. [/QUOTE]
